Como instalar o Postgresql 9.3 em vez do padrão 9.4 no Ubuntu 14.10?

2

Estou no Unicórnio Utópico e preciso instalar o servidor e cliente Postgresql 9.3. Quando tento autocompletar sudo apt-get install postgres , vejo apenas 9,4 pacotes:

postgresql                          postgresql-autodoc
postgresql-9.4                      postgresql-client
postgresql-9.4-asn1oid              postgresql-client-9.4
postgresql-9.4-dbg                  postgresql-client-common
postgresql-9.4-debversion           postgresql-common
postgresql-9.4-ip4r                 postgresql-comparator
postgresql-9.4-orafce               postgresql-contrib
postgresql-9.4-pgespresso           postgresql-contrib-9.4
postgresql-9.4-pgextwlist           postgresql-doc
postgresql-9.4-pgfincore            postgresql-doc-9.4
postgresql-9.4-pgmemcache           postgresql-filedump
postgresql-9.4-pgmp                 postgresql-hll
postgresql-9.4-pgpool2              postgresql-plperl-9.4
postgresql-9.4-pgq3                 postgresql-plpython3-9.4
postgresql-9.4-pgrouting            postgresql-plpython-9.4
postgresql-9.4-pgrouting-doc        postgresql-pltcl-9.4
postgresql-9.4-pllua                postgresql-prioritize
postgresql-9.4-plproxy              postgresql-server-dev-9.4
postgresql-9.4-plr                  postgresql-server-dev-all
postgresql-9.4-plsh                 postgres-xc
postgresql-9.4-plv8                 postgres-xc-client
postgresql-9.4-postgis-2.1          postgres-xc-contrib
postgresql-9.4-postgis-2.1-scripts  postgres-xc-dbg
postgresql-9.4-postgis-scripts      postgres-xc-doc
postgresql-9.4-prefix               postgres-xc-plperl
postgresql-9.4-preprepare           postgres-xc-plpython
postgresql-9.4-repmgr               postgres-xc-pltcl
postgresql-9.4-slony1-2             postgres-xc-server-dev

Como posso instalar suas 9.3 versões?

    
por Sergey Filkin 06.11.2014 / 08:36

2 respostas

5

Adicione o repositório oficial PPA / Apt do postgres. Tem pacotes para todas as versões suportadas.

Veja: link

  • Crie o arquivo /etc/apt/sources.list.d/pgdg.list e adicione uma linha ao repositório
    • deb http://apt.postgresql.org/pub/repos/apt/ utopic-pgdg main
  • Importe a chave de assinatura do repositório e atualize as listas de pacotes
    • wget --quiet -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c | \ sudo apt-key add -
    • sudo apt-get update
por DivinusVox 06.11.2014 / 08:40
1

A partir da página de downloads do PostgreSQL :

  

Se a versão incluída na sua versão do Ubuntu não é a que você   quer, você pode usar o Repositório de PostgreSQL Apt. Este repositório   integrar com seus sistemas normais e gerenciamento de patches, e fornecer   atualizações automáticas para todas as versões suportadas do PostgreSQL   o tempo de vida de suporte do PostgreSQL.

     

O repositório apt do PostgreSQL suporta versões LTS do Ubuntu, 10.04   e 12.04, nas arquiteturas amd64 e i386. Embora não seja totalmente suportado,   os pacotes geralmente funcionam em versões não-LTS, usando o   versão LTS mais próxima disponível.

Para adicionar o repositório do PostgreSQL:

sudo tee /etc/apt/sources.list.d/pgdg.list <<EOF
deb http://apt.postgresql.org/pub/repos/apt/ utopic-pgdg main
EOF
wget --quiet -O - https://www.postgresql.org/media/keys/ACCC4CF8.asc | sudo apt-key add -
sudo apt-get update

(Sim, apesar do que parece, eles suportam 14.10.)

    
por muru 06.11.2014 / 08:40